Biden’S Options: Policy Recommendations On The Us-China Trade War, Marley Taylor Belanger
Biden’S Options: Policy Recommendations On The Us-China Trade War, Marley Taylor Belanger
Undergraduate Theses and Capstone Projects
As talks of unprecedented inflation and the long-term impact of the pandemic are on the rise in the United States, it is critical to understand how the foreign policy choices of the US Government ultimately impact its economy. This paper aims to evaluate the impact of the economic tensions between the US and China as a result of the ongoing US-China Trade War. To examine the viability of proposed options, a cost-benefit analysis of Biden’s policy options is implemented based on a framework of escalation, de-escalation, or modification of the current US-China economic policy initiative. The Economic Impact Of U.S. Drone Strikes On Pakistan, Cavika Prashad
The Economic Impact Of U.S. Drone Strikes On Pakistan, Cavika Prashad
Honors College Theses
Drone strikes have a detrimental impact on the region of a nation, especially when the contact is not the targeted threat. When drone strikes are sent out, they result in consequences such as death, infrastructure damage, and consequently, unemployment increases. While proponents of drone strikes say they are precise weapons with little disruption to civilian life, this paper shows that in Pakistan, U.S. drone strikes have had an economic impact, particularly by increasing unemployment.
